Multiple MySQL database Zero-day vulnerabilities published

Researcher discovered Multiple Zero-day vulnerabilities in MySQL database software including Stack based buffer overrun, Heap Based Overrun, Privilege Elevation, Denial of Service and Remote Preauth User Enumeration. CVE-2012-5611

CVE-2012-5611 is a stack-based buffer overflow in the MySQL acl_get/user permission checking path. An authenticated remote user could crash mysqld or potentially execute arbitrary code.
